The Milwaukee Brewers have optioned pitcher Trevor Megill to Triple-A Nashville on Thursday.
Fantasy Impact
Megill and Toro were sent to the minors on Thursday as the team added reliever Andrew Chafin to the active roster while Brian Anderson (back) came off the IL. The right-hander has appeared in 16 games with the Brewers this season, pitching to a 5.09 ERA in that time, although his 2.65 FIP and 3.26 SIERA suggest he has been much better than his ERA would suggest.
Trevor Megill tossed one scoreless inning with one strikeout to earn the win over the Royals Thursday.
Fantasy Impact
Megill has a 3.89 ERA, 1.37 WHIP, and a .267 BAA in 41 2/3 innings pitched this season. The 28-year-old has struggled as of late, posting a 5.63 ERA in his last seven outings. Fantasy managers should leave Megill on the waiver wire.
Trevor Megill pitched 2/3 of an inning, allowing three hits, and one earned run Wednesday. He tallied his third loss of the season in game one of a doubleheader with the Yankees.
Fantasy Impact
Megill has a 4.12 ERA, .275 BAA, and a 9.61 K/9 ratio in 33 appearances this season. The 28-year-old has pitched well over the course of the season, but has struggled over his last seven games. He has allowed seven earned runs and 16 baserunners in 7 2/3 innings during that span. Fantasy managers should leave Megill on the waiver wire.
Trevor Megill pitched one inning, allowing two hits, one walk, and two earned runs Monday. He tallied his second loss of the season in a 5-2 loss to the Yankees.
Fantasy Impact
Megill allowed a two-run home runs to Aaron Judge, which is nothing to hang your head over this season. The 28-year-old has a 3.96 ERA, .264 BAA, and a 9.54 K/9 ratio in 32 appearances this season. Megill has worked more in a middle relief role and does not hold any fantasy value.
Trevor Megill pitched one inning, allowing no runs or hits and picked up his third win of the season over the Blue Jays Saturday.
Fantasy Impact
Megill has put together a solid stat line through 21 appearances this season. The 28-year-old has a 2.81 ERA, .219 OBA, and a 8.77 K/9 ratio in 25 2/3 innings pitched.
